About Union Properties Union Properties PJSC (UP), one of the United Arab Emirates (UAE) leading property investment developers, is listed on the Dubai Stock Exchange. UP will be celebrating its 25 year anniversary next year. A culmination of many years of growth, innovation and attention to detail. UP has earned an reputation for professionalism and integrity throughout the UAE, serving public institutions, multinational corporations, the business community and the private sector. In 1987, UP s net assets were worth AED one million (approximately $ 275,000 USD) and in 2008 the company had an annual turnover of more than AED 3.6 billion (equivalent to $ 1 billion USD).
About Union Properties Highly regarded and praised for its innovation and the quality of its products, UP maintains one of the most credible and trustworthy property brands in the Middle East. UP s business structure is vertically integrated and includes the following business lines; Property investment and development Property management Interior design and fit-out Project management Facilities management Electro-mechanical contracting Serviced offices Hospitality Leisure
